Scenario

Your school is having a parade to celebrate America. There will be a Grand Marshall to lead the parade. There will be floats showing symbols of our country.

Task and  Product 

As a participant of the parade representing American patriotism, you will design and create a hat representing one of the following symbols for the parade.

  • American Flag
  • Statue of Liberty
  • Liberty Bell
  • Mt. Rushmore
  • Bald Eagle
  • Other choice as approved by your teacher

After the parade, all hats will be on display. You will need to include an information card explaining the significance of your symbol. Your teacher may also have your class create a Symbols of American Pride Video Quiz Show.

Question

Why are these symbols important to Americans?
How do they represent America?

 Organize Ideas to Create Something New

Analyze your research graphic organizer to determine:

  • How the symbol represents America?
  • Why this symbol is important to Americans?

Synthesize your findings by creating your hat and writing the information card. (Synthesis is the act of pulling your research and ideas together to form new meaning.)

  • What new ideas have you formed about American patriotism?
  • Which facts should be on your information card?
  • Create your hat, reflecting an American symbol.

Evaluate your research for the information card.

  • Have you gathered enough information to write your information card?

Review your hat design checklist to make sure you have included all the information required.

Conclude

Show your hat to your class and explain how the symbol represents America and why this symbol is important to Americans.

As a class, discuss:

  • Why do Americans need patriotic symbols?
  • What purpose do patriotic symbols serve?
